Overview
Job title: Senior Back End Developer
Location: Kochi, Kerala, India (Hybrid)
Permanent, Full Time.
About Us:
Cyncly is a global technology powerhouse with 2,400+ employees and 70,000+ customers across 100+ countries. Cyncly transforms the way customizable products and spaces are imagined, designed, sold, managed and made. Our end-to-end software solutions connect professional designers, retailers and manufacturers to the world's largest repository of product content. Today, our business spans across the Kitchen & Bath, Furniture, Window, Glass & Door, and Flooring industries with operations in North & South America, Europe, Asia Pacific and Africa.
Cyncly brings over 30 years of experience to deliver more value for our customers through an expanded portfolio of end-to-end solutions. Our global presence allows us to provide world-class support and sales with a local touch, providing the best possible customer experience.
Cyncly is now embarking on an exciting journey as we continue to expand through strong organic growth and complementary acquisitions, backed by leading growth private equity firms specializing in technology.
Build Your Career with Cyncly in Kochi
Kochi is Cyncly’s newest hub, opening doors to exciting career opportunities across diverse functions. Here, you’ll collaborate with global experts, engage in innovative projects, and grow in a culture that values innovation, flexibility, and continuous learning. With access to top mentors, excellent learning resources, and a flexible and autonomous working environment, you’ll have everything you need to thrive.
Make it amazing—take your career to the next level with Cyncly in Kochi!
Vision
Working closely with product management, content authors and service team, the content acquisition team acts as the Cyncly world ambassador to collect content from various sources including commercial definition, pricing and graphical representation.
Ambassador of the content acquisition format, they are responsible for understanding the various formats used in the market including the various content definition used by Cyncly applications.
Understanding the various standards from the industry (e.g.: IDM), they formalize and transform the various content to provide a normalized rich representation of the content.
Mission
Content being key for the enterprise, the team is responsible for gathering all potential content from the industry and making it available in the content platform.
This group is responsible for building automated scalable pipelines of content based on various formats. Generic pipelines will support various standards from the industry but will also accommodate the various custom formats.
In addition to collecting various content, they represent the content platform in the field and gather new requirements in terms of content definition based on their learning and needs from the market.
Working in collaboration with various partners from in-house applications, retailers, and manufacturers, they capture all the richness of their content and expose all the potential of content platform capabilities.
To achieve the mission, one of the first objectives will be to collect ALL content from Cyncly applications.
Developer:
Reporting to the development Team Leader, the employee will bring a valuable collaboration in the system architecture, design pattern, programming and testing of the content acquisition services.
Technical leadership, strong interest in software quality and knowledge of the best practices regarding deployment to the cloud are expected from the employee.
In collaboration with other team members, the incumbent will work on challenging projects, integrating advanced web technologies. He will participate in the elaboration, analysis and functionality development of a state-of-the-art back-end web platform. The content acquisition is of the key components of the content platform which expose content as the foundation of many other products developed at Cyncly.
Roles and responsibilities:
- Web development using a multi-tier architecture and Service Oriented Architecture.
- Architecture and conception of services components.
- Involved in automated deployment for internal builds and Cloud solution.
- Search for the best applicable process or algorithms.
- Participate in design reviews of services.
- Use Test Driven Development process.
- Meet the established development standard (security, performance).
- Perform the duties according to timelines.
- Participate in team meetings.
Qualifications:
- College or bachelor's degree in computer science or computer Engineering.
- Minimum of seven (7) years of relevant experience in web programming.
- Fluency in spoken and written English is required.
- Technical leadership.
Required technical skills:
- Proficiency in Back End Web technologies (Software as a Service).
- Proficiency in C#, .Net, .Net core development.
- Strong experience with Cloud infrastructure (Azure).
- Experience with unit test framework.
- Experience with defining architecture for large scales back end project (security, reliability, performance…).
- Experience with protocols based on REST/JSON.
- Development experience in Microsoft Visual Studio environment.
- Knowledge of Databases (SQL, Document DB).
- Experience with software source code management (GIT).
- Proficiency at doing code review of peers.
Good to have - technical skills
- Orchestration pattern using Azure.
- Knowledge of Agile (scrum) methodologies – Asset.
- Knowledge of 3D geometries – Asset.
Required qualities
- Interest in software quality.
- Pursuit of excellence.
- Autonomy and organization skills.
- Methodological and rigorous.
- Excellent oral communication skills.
- Sense of initiative and innovation.
- Team spirit.
- Flexibility.
- Good sense of humour.
- Open minded.
Working for Us
At Cyncly, we’re a global family that collaborates with humility and respect for one another. With more than 2,400 employees around the world, we not only recognize our diverse perspectives, we champion our different outlooks and firmly believe it to be what makes us better together.
You can expect to work in a supportive and nurturing environment, with experts in their fields who strive for quality and excellence without compromising others. We also believe in a flexible and autonomous working environment, focused on the continual growth of our employees.
Diversity of experience and skills combined with passion is a key to innovation and brilliance, so we encourage applicants from all backgrounds to apply to our roles.
That’s who we are: A team that recognizes our strength is in working together to not only get things done, but also lead the industry with a bold approach that’s dedicated to making our customers better. Come join us.